We have access to a PIONEER continuous flow Peptide Synthesis System instrument
(departmental equipment). Here we synthesize isotopically labeled fragments of the β2
microglobulin protein. |

| The BioCAD Sprint HPLC (departmental equipment) is used to purify our synthetic
peptides. |

This HP 8452A UV/Vis is used to confirm fibril formation in solution via
observation of a red-shift of the congo red spectrum upon binding to amyloid fibrils. |

| Here is our 359.5 MHz widebore NMR magnet (8.44 T) with a 3 channel Tecmag
Apollo console. It does not have a lock channel, so it is primarily suitable only for
solid-state NMR experiments. |

Our homebuilt two channel (HX) Magic Angle Spinning probe for the 360 MHz
widebore magnet. It has a 3.2mm stator which will spin the sample at speeds of up to 24 kHz.
The probe is removed from the magnet for a sample change and is then returned into the
magnet from below. |

The HP8712ET spectrum analyzer is used for testing during the manufacture
of probes and other homebuilt RF devices. It can also be used for tuning the probe. |
